Hi. I went to my first weigh-in and "Educational Class" today. I loved it. So much support and it was great to see the people who had surgery just yesterday and people who are in all phases of the process (months to surgery to 6 mos post surgery). This class is "taught" by the surgeon who will do my surgery. So informative.
I am starting my 1200 calorie/day diet for this week. I have to lose 1 pound by next Tuesday, February 24. Then on the 24th I have to start my 2-weeks of Optifast 800 calorie/day diet for two weeks before surgery. Never thought I'd be so worried about losing 1 pound. But have to do it because if not my surgery will be delayed into April.
FYI my surgery is scheduled for March 10th.
Getting really anxious. Once again I wonder how it could feel so close yet so far away.
